No. Only female cockroaches lay eggs. There is no male insect of any kind which lays the eggs. A female cockroach will lay anywhere between 10 and 40 eggs in a batch, and a total of around 30 batches of eggs during her lifetime.

Male seahorses dont lay eggs the female passes the fertilized eggs to a pouch in his abdomen where they hatch and he then gives"birth" to the babies.
Cockroaches reproduce through mating, where the male transfers sperm to the female. The female cockroach can then lay eggs, which are protected in a casing called an ootheca until they hatch.
